Settings > Course administration > Grades > Outcomes report Settings > Grade administration > Outcomes report

The outcomes report helps teachers monitor their students' progress using Outcomes. It lists site-wide outcomes and custom outcomes used in the current course, their overall average (each outcome can be measured through many grade items). It will show the name, course and site wide average, the activity, the average values and the number of "grades" given.

Description of report columns

The outcomes report is a table with 6 columns:

  • Short name - the short name of the outcome used in this course.
  • Course average -shows two values representing the average scores given to students for each outcome used in this course.
  • Site-wide - Whether the outcome is a site-wide outcome or not.
  • Activities - This lists the activities that use this outcome in this course. A new row is created for each activity, and the activity name is linked to the activity's page.
  • Average - the average score for each activity using the outcome in this course.
  • Number of Grades - The number of grades given to students for each activity using the outcome.
